Within the royal family, women curtsy to the monarch and senior members of the royal family, while men bow their heads. But Charles and Camilla are often seen greeting their family members with hugs, or kisses on the cheek afterwards.
The Firm gathered to celebrate the oldest and most senior Order of Chivalry in Britain. The Most Noble Order of the Garter is the world’s oldest national order of knighthood. It is around 700 years old after it was started by King Edward III, who was inspired by the stories of King Arthur and the Knights of the Round Table. There are 24 companions in the Order, including the monarch, the Prince of Wales and other royals from the UK and abroad.
